Analysis

Bulgaria recorded 16.07 for sdg indicator 9.2.2: manufacturing employment as a proportion of in 2025. That is the lowest value across all 26 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 9.9% on the previous year and down 19.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, sdg indicator 9.2.2: manufacturing employment as a proportion of in Bulgaria peaked at 24.45 in 2005 and was at its lowest, 16.07, in 2025.

Bulgaria ranks 23rd of 156 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 26 years of available data.

SDG indicator 9.2.2: Manufacturing employment as a proportion of in Bulgaria, year by year

Annual values for SDG indicator 9.2.2: Manufacturing employment as a proportion of total employment (previous ILO definition - ICLS13) in Bulgaria, 2000 to 2025.
Year Value Change
2000 23.41
2001 24.06 +2.7%
2002 23.81 -1.0%
2003 23.34 -2.0%
2004 23.87 +2.3%
2005 24.45 +2.4%
2006 23.96 -2.0%
2007 23.57 -1.6%
2008 23.16 -1.7%
2009 22.19 -4.2%
2010 20.96 -5.6%
2011 19.49 -7.0%
2012 20.83 +6.8%
2013 19.76 -5.1%
2014 19.23 -2.7%
2015 19.86 +3.2%
2016 19.99 +0.7%
2017 18.65 -6.7%
2018 19.02 +1.9%
2019 18.58 -2.3%
2020 18.55 -0.1%
2021 18.3 -1.4%
2022 18.32 +0.1%
2023 18.06 -1.4%
2024 17.84 -1.3%
2025 16.07 -9.9%

Data may differ from nationally reported figures and the Global SDG Indicators Database due to differences in sources and/or reference years. This indicator conveys the share of employment in manufacturing. Employment in manufacturing is defined based on the International Standard Industrial Classification of All Economic Activities (ISIC). Employment refers to all persons of working age who, during a specified brief period, were in paid employment (whether at work or with a job but not at work) or in self-employment (whether at work or with an enterprise but not at work). This indicator is calculated based on data on employment by sex and economic activity. For more information, refer to the Labour Market-related SDG Indicators (ILOSDG) database description.
